This record provides the operational “map layer” for the Operator Closure Constraint (OCC) research program. It specifies how the core artifacts—(i) OCC: The First Principle, (ii) OCC: Formal Specification and Adversarial Test Charter, (iii) Closure-Pathogen Postulates (CHP), and (iv) an OCC Field Audit / Worked Example—compose into a single deployment workflow with explicit evidence gates and claim permissions.
The map resolves two recurring implementation failure modes by forcing upfront declarations: (1) a return-work counting-rule fork distinguishing non-durable attempts (ρnd\rho_{nd}ρnd, binary per attempt) from reopen-event counts (ρevt\rho_{evt}ρevt, potentially multiple events per attempt), and (2) an exit-rate formulation for durable settlement (μdexit\mu_d^{exit}μdexit) that removes horizon-lag ambiguity in boundary conservation checks. It also formalizes the separation between deployment disconfirmation (invalid instrumentation, boundary drift, unit drift, reopen incompleteness, or metric contamination) and mechanism falsification (a sustained regime that improves durable settlement under real contestability without any conserved outputs rising, under Charter-compliant measurement).
Annex A includes a standardized OCC Deployment Report Template that functions as the required reporting interface for deployments, reducing omission risk and enabling cross-study comparability.
